Paris Hosts Musical Evening Celebrating 140th Anniversary of Azerbaijani Composer Uzeyir Hajibayli

Paris: A musical evening marking the 140th anniversary of the birth of the outstanding Azerbaijani composer Uzeyir Hajibayli was held in Paris, co-organized by the Fund for Support to Azerbaijani Diaspora and pianist Saida Zulfugarova. The event celebrated Hajibayli’s significant contribution to Azerbaijani music and culture.

According to Azerbaijan State News Agency, the evening opened with “Ashiqsayagi,” one of the main pearls of Uzeyir Hajibayli’s musical heritage. This symbolic piece, deeply rooted in Azerbaijani musical tradition, created an atmosphere of artistic dialogue between the national musical heritage and the modernity of the 20th century.

The event was attended by notable figures including Ambassador of Azerbaijan to France Leyla Abdullayeva, UNESCO Artist for Peace Hedva Ser, and a representative of the Ambassador of Mongolia to France, showcasing the international recognition and admiration for Hajibayli’s work.
